Meet this week’s “Special Person of the Week Eileen O’Connor
Eileen O’Connor grew up in Ball Square in Somerville where she was lucky to have maintained lifelong friendships.
She spent summers attending Somerville Recreation at the Brown School as a child where she mastered the skills of jacks and dodgeball.
Eileen was involved with Pop Warner Cheerleading for several years and eventually went on coach C Team Girls for a year.
She attended St. Clements School for 12 years and today she’s a paralegal who has been legal assisting for over 25 years.
After graduating from Katharine Gibbs School and landing a pretty good job with F. Lee Bailey, Esq., Eileen attended Suffolk University part time and majored in Sociology/Criminology and Law.
She also earned a brown belt in karate at Fred Villari Studios in Union Square while she still visits and supports her favorite local Somerville parish, eateries, bakeries and local Somerville pubs still to date.
